Attribute mit mehreren Werten (Windows Media Player SDK)
Einige Medienelementattribute können mehrere Werte aufweisen. Beispielsweise können die Attribute Author, WM/Composer und WM/Genre jeweils mehr als einen Wert aufweisen. Der Datentyp solcher Attribute ist eine mehrwertige Zeichenfolge.
In Windows Media Player zeigt die Bibliothek mehrere Werte in einem einzelnen Feld an, wobei die Werte durch Semikolons getrennt werden. Allerdings ist jeder Wert tatsächlich ein separates Attribut im Windows Media-Element.
Sie können Code schreiben, der bestimmt, ob ein bestimmtes Attribut über mehrere Werte verfügt, und dann alle diese Werte abrufen. Sie müssen Medien verwenden. getItemInfoByType. Wenn Sie die Medien verwenden. getItemInfo-Methode zum Abrufen eines mehrwertigen Attributs. Sie rufen nur den ersten Wert ab.
Das letzte Beispiel im Thema Lesen von Attributwerten veranschaulicht die Verwendung von Media. getAttributeCountByType und Media. getItemInfoByType-Methoden zum Abrufen mehrerer Werte für ein bestimmtes Attribut.